WHY AUTUMN'S THE IDEAL TIME TO GET YOURSELF A HEALTH MOT, BY CAMILLA FOSTER

- CAMILLA FOSTER

STARTING to feel increasingly mentally and physically drained as the days grow shorter? You aren’t alone.

"This time of year is a perfect storm for illnesses because we've got reduced sunlight that leads to lower vitamin D levels, which is essential for immune function,” explains Dr Elise Dallas, GP at The London General Practice. “Also, the environment gets colder and the air gets drier, so mucous membranes in the nose and the throat, which are the body’s first defence system, get less good at fighting the airborne viruses.”

Here are eight easy expert-backed ways to conduct an autumn health MOT to reset your body and boost your health for the chillier months ahead...
